MISS LINDA NORGAAARD

Authorized Official CLINIC MANAGER

MISS LINDA NORGAAARD is the CLINIC MANAGER of PAUL ANDERSON in SPENCER, IA, US.

A 1200 1ST AVE E, SPENCER, IA, US
7122621808
No ratings yet

Associated Clinics & Hospitals